36. Fabrication and characterisation of RGB LEDs based on nanowire technology
University essay from Lunds universitet/Fasta tillståndets fysik; Lunds universitet/Fysiska institutionenAbstract : The white light LEDs of today are usually based on a blue LED and a phosphor, converting the blue light to longer wavelengths. While these phosphor-converted LEDs are extremely efficient compared to incandescent light or fluorescent light, there is still plenty of room for improvement. READ MORE

39. Using Blue Mussels as a Tool for Mitigating Eutrophication in the Baltic Sea
University essay from Linköpings universitet/Industriell miljöteknikAbstract : Eutrophication is a consequence of excess nutrients in the water which leads to increased algaegrowth, reduced water transparency and hypoxic bottoms. This is the biggest environmental problemfor the Baltic Sea which recently has resulted in stricter legislations and other initiatives to help theBaltic Sea to recover. READ MORE
